Planning Your Lighting Setup
Before installing your lighting grid, consider the size of your space, the type of interview (formal, casual, etc.), and the mood you want to create. Measure the ceiling height and decide where to position the lights for optimal coverage. Choose adjustable fixtures to allow for easy modifications.
Choosing the Right Equipment
- Lighting trusses or grids: sturdy and adjustable
- LED panel lights or softboxes for soft, even light
- Clamps and safety cables for secure mounting
- Dimmers and control units for brightness adjustment
- Color gels or filters for color correction
Installing the Lighting Grid
Begin by securely attaching the lighting trusses or grid system to the ceiling. Ensure that the mounting points are capable of supporting the weight of your equipment. Use safety cables to prevent accidents. Once the grid is in place, hang your lights at appropriate angles to cover the entire interview area evenly.
Positioning Your Lights
- Place key lights at a 45-degree angle from the subject to reduce shadows
- Use fill lights to soften shadows and balance exposure
- Backlights or hair lights can add depth and separation from the background
Final Adjustments and Testing
After installation, turn on all lights and check the illumination. Use a camera or smartphone to preview the footage. Adjust the angles, brightness, and color temperature as needed to achieve even, natural lighting. Regularly inspect your setup to ensure all fixtures remain secure and functional.
